Caterpillar Soars on AI Data Center Demand Boost

Caterpillar Inc. shares recorded their biggest gain in 16 years following impressive quarterly results that exceeded Wall Street expectations. The surge was driven by unprecedented demand for the company’s power-generation equipment from AI data centers. This performance highlights how traditional industrial companies are benefiting from the artificial intelligence boom, with the energy and transportation division posting a 17% revenue jump that significantly outpaced growth in traditional mining and construction segments.

AI Job Loss Threat: 300M Positions at Risk

Artificial intelligence threatens to eliminate millions of jobs worldwide while simultaneously boosting productivity, creating a dangerous economic paradox. Experts debate whether AI-driven efficiency could trigger economic recession through widespread unemployment, with Goldman Sachs research predicting 300 million global job losses. The transition may leave many workers struggling to adapt to new economic realities as companies like Caterpillar already implement AI systems that replace field workers with control room operators.

Bedrock Robotics Raises $80M for AI Construction Tech

Bedrock Robotics, a startup specializing in AI-driven automation for construction equipment, has raised $80 million to address the industry’s labor shortage and safety concerns. The company retrofits traditional heavy machinery with cameras, sensors, and machine-learning software to enable autonomous operation, with plans for fully operator-less deployments by 2026. Founder Boris Sofman highlights the urgent need for automation due to a half-million-worker shortfall and rising project demands. The technology not only boosts efficiency but also reduces workplace injuries, which claimed 738 lives in 2022 alone. Bedrock joins competitors like Built Robotics and SafeAI in a rapidly growing market projected to hit $8 billion by 2033.
